Ex-situ Modification of Ganzhou Cigarette Factory Starts

Write: Shaun [2011-05-20]

The ex-situ technical modification of Ganzhou Cigarette Factory of China Tobacco Jiangxi Industrial LLC held a ceremony of laying foundation stone in Ganzhou Development Zone on April 1. (Photo by Liu Jun, Reporter Guo Zhiyong)

The ex-situ technical modification of Ganzhou Cigarette Factory started in Hong Kong Industrial Park of Ganzhou Development Zone on the morning of April 1. The project takes a total investment of about RMB 2.2 billion and is expected to realize annual capacity of 600,000 boxes of cigarettes.

According to the plan, an automatic, modernized and intellectualized garden-like factory will be built up to cover 730 mu by the end of 2013.

Jiang Chengkang, general director of China Tobacco Monopoly Bureau, Li Keming, deputy director of China Tobacco Monopoly Bureau, Zhang Yuxia, chief accountant of China Tobacco Monopoly Bureau, Shi Wenqing, vice governor of Jiangxi and Party secretary of CPC Ganzhou Municipal Committee, Xie Bilian, director of Jiangxi Provincial Industry and Information Commission, and Ganzhou mayor Wang Ping attended the groundbreaking ceremony.

Hu Shizhong, deputy secretary-general of Jiangxi Province, chaired the ceremony.

Zheng Wei, general manager of China Tobacco Jiangxi Industrial LLC, introduced the project.

Ganzhou leaders Wan Ming and Liu Cong, etc. were present at the ceremony.
